Hi, quick summary for your records. We moved the Graphlace dependency graph visualizer from the old Pinwheel cluster to the new Corvane environment last night. Render times dropped noticeably, and the edge-bundling cache rebuilt without intervention. Two stale dashboards in the Mossford team space still point at the retired endpoint; owners have been notified. Rollback window closes Friday, after which the Pinwheel instance is decommissioned. For sign-off, the production service is now running with the following configuration.

config for kafof-bawef:
holath:
  log_level: debug
  metrics_host: metrics.holath.qorvelsys.internal
  pin: 2191
  pool_size: 32

Watchdog notes for the Brightfoyer kiosk app: the watchdog process pings the UI layer every 20 seconds and restarts it after three missed heartbeats. Restarts are logged to the local journal and synced nightly. If a kiosk enters a restart loop, pull it from rotation via the Fleetboard console before debugging on-site. The watchdog reads its heartbeat thresholds from the central config table, so verify connectivity first. Use the connection string below.

warehouse DSN: mongodb://istix_svc:817yvf7L11ZXwo@db-bf0a.kelvicorp.internal:5432/praath

MEMO — Records team

Quick heads-up: the old film reels from the Dunnery screening room are finally headed to the Calloway Archive this Friday. They're boxed and labeled in the storeroom — please don't reshuffle them, the order matters. A courier from Merrow Freight will collect them around 10. For the hand-over itself, follow the confidential instruction below:

handover note for yagef-bagep: the drudor pelius courier leaves the kasdor zorvan norir ledger at gate 8016 under passcode 755406

Leadership Review — Closure of Dunmere Office

Decision pending: shut the Dunmere satellite office. Headcount: nine, all remote-capable. Lease expires in four months; no penalty if we give notice by the 15th. Savings roughly offset relocation stipends in year one, net positive thereafter. Regional sales coverage unaffected per Halvard's assessment. Client-facing staff retain Dunmere territory. Recommend approval at Thursday's review. One sensitivity: the closure connects to broader restructuring, summarised confidentially below.

management briefing: Project Ulavan slips by two quarters because of the staffing delay.